McDonald’s Revives McDonaldland Characters with New Menu Items and Immersive Experience

McDonald’s is welcoming back its beloved McDonaldland characters, including Grimace and the Hamburglar, as part of a nostalgic campaign designed to engage fans of all ages. The new limited-time shake, called the Mt. McDonaldland shake, comes out August 12. Consumers will have the opportunity to experience an amazing immersive experience transporting them to the imaginative world of McDonaldland.

This recent initiative seems to be an effort to leverage the nostalgia that surrounds McDonaldland while developing a memorable customer experience. These characters have historically been the face of McDonaldland, charming children of all ages for decades with their whimsical hijinks and vibrant storylines. Jennifer “JJ” Healan, Vice President of U.S. marketing, brand, content, and culture for McDonald’s, pointed to the enduring appeal of those characters.

“Over the past few years we’ve seen how fans flock to our characters, everyone from Grimace to the Hamburglar,” – Jennifer “JJ” Healan, McDonald’s VP of U.S. marketing, brand, content and culture.
